This publication implements Air Force Policy Directive (AFPD) 36-1, Appropriated Funds Civilian
Management and Administration and supplements Department of Defense Instruction (DoDI)
1400.25, Volume 771, DoD Civilian Personnel Management System: Administrative Grievance
System.” The DoDI is printed word-for-word in regular font without editorial review. Department
of the Air Force (DAF) supplementary content follows “(Added)(DAF).” It contains guidance and
procedures for considering non-bargaining civilian employee grievances. It reflects the policies of
the Secretary of the Air Force concerning matters that are discretionary within DAF. It applies to
United States citizen civilian employees of the DAF who are paid from appropriated
funds and who are either non-bargaining unit employees, or bargaining unit employees in a unit
where no collective bargaining agreement has been negotiated, or where the negotiated procedure
excludes the matters at issue. It also applies to supervisors, civilian personnel officers, career Senior
Executive Service (SES), Senior Level, Scientific or Professional, and other management officials of
both United States Air Force and the United States Space Force. This instruction applies to
appropriated fund civilian employees, administered under Title 5 United States Code (USC),
including Air Force Reserve personnel, United States citizens assigned to foreign overseas areas,
